Hair Follicle Drug Testing Services

Hair follicle drug testing in Farmingville, New York provides a reliable method to detect long-term drug use by analyzing a small sample of hair. Drugs enter the hair shaft through the bloodstream, allowing this testing method to reveal usage patterns over months. It is less invasive and highly accurate for extended detection.

Fingernail Drug Testing Services

Fingernail drug testing in Farmingville, New York offers a relatively long detection window for drug usage by analyzing substances deposited in nails over time. This method is particularly useful for its difficulty to alter or tamper with, making it a reliable choice for many legal and employment applications.

Learn More

What is the Detection Window for Fingernail Drug Tests

  • Fingernails: Typically showcases drug use history up to six months.
  • Toenails: May reveal drug usage data for up to a year.

If an initial screen is not negative, the sample goes through confirmatory testing using more specific analytical methods. Final results are not reported until confirmation is complete to ensure accuracy and defensibility.

Common specimen types include urine, hair, saliva/oral fluid, and breath (for alcohol). Each method supports different needs: urine is widely used for workplace testing, hair provides a longer detection history, saliva/oral fluid can capture more recent use, and breath alcohol testing measures current alcohol concentration.
